How they compare
Sudan currently reports 116.61 current US$ against 106.31 current US$ in Uruguay, a difference of 10.3 current US$.
That makes Sudan's figure about 1.1 times Uruguay's.
Across all 9 years both countries report, Sudan has been ahead every year.
Sudan ranks 61st and Uruguay ranks 64th of 149 countries.
Sudan has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
